Output 26c04a411e3fc86b376bc3fe34a174cfaf60e150694e9d478b2149be5ec36c30:1

value
668246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7b7c8096598a0967d33802c5fd891a5bbe488ba OP_EQUAL
address
3QGpzHFLkGzCPastmZcHWh7fh7T8Joe784
transaction
26c04a411e3fc86b376bc3fe34a174cfaf60e150694e9d478b2149be5ec36c30
spent
true